Ceisteanna—Questions. Oral Answers. - Army Duty Periods.

32.

asked the Minister for Defence if he is aware that Army personnel engaged on security operations are on duty for periods of 30 hours at a time; if he considers this excessive; and what steps he proposes to take to remedy the matter.

It is unavoidable, in present circumstances, that personnel on security duties are, on occasions, on duty for such periods. The hours of duty, however, normally include periods spent on "stand-to" when no actual work is done and the personnel may rest. They normally receive time off after a lengthy period of duty, proportionate to the time spent on duty.
